First published in 1904, Paget's Law of Banking has established itself as the leading practitioner text on banking law, combining meticulous accuracy and depth with a clear approach to this complex area. The 14th edition has been updated and expanded to provide a thoroughly modern approach to the subject matter, while remaining unique in providing a comprehensive, clear and accurate statement of the law of banking, with a particular emphasis on the principles which underpin the case law.
Part 1 – The Regulatory Framework; 1 Bank Regulation; 2 Money Laundering; 3 Protecting and Disclosing Information; Part 2 – Banks and Customers; 4 The Relationship and Contract of Banker and Customer; 5 Types of Account; 6 Special Customers; 7 Safe Custody; Part 3 – Bank Lending; 8 Loans; 9 Consumer Credit; 10 Appropriation of Payments; 11 Hierarchies of Lending; 12 Syndicated Lending; Part 4 – Security; 13 The Taking of Security; 14 Lien and Set-Off; 15 Charges over Debts; 16 Pledges; 17 Mortgages of Land; 18 Guarantees; Part 5 – Customer Insolvency; 19 Insolvency Jurisdictions; 20 Company Insolvencies; 21 Individual Insolvencies; Part 6 – Payments; 22 The Paying Bank – Obligations between Bank and Customer; 23 Unauthorised Payments; 24 The Payment Services Regulations; 25 Electronic Payment Systems; 26 Cheques; 27 Cheques and Conversion; 28 Restitution, Proprietary Claims and Tracing; Part 7 – Investments and Financial Products; 29 Advising on Financial Products; 30 Retail Derivatives; Part 8 – Interference by Third Parties; 31 Attachment; 32 Freezing Injunctions; 33 Compulsory Disclosure; Part 9 – Letters of Credit and Performance Bonds; 34 Demand Guarantees and Performance Bonds; 35 Documentary Credits: General; 36 Documentary Credits: the Presentation, Examination and Rejection of Documents; 37 Documentary Credits: Compliance of Documents.
